Acorns uses micro-savings to collect small amounts of money from everyday purchases to build an investment account. The app can sync to your bank accounts, allowing it to track every transaction. Below is a list of apps that can help you to save money by connecting to your existing bank account. The apps analyse your spending habits and can automatically put money aside based on an algorithm. If you choose to save with any of the below apps, your money is saved in an account with the app and not with your bank.
